Community HealthPathways is the best source of up-to-date referral information for adult ADHD support.
Pinnacle primary mental health (PMH) services, like those in general practice, have not been commissioned, contracted, or funded to support adult ADHD screening, assessment, medication initiation, or ongoing care.
Referrals to PMH for ADHD diagnosis or pathway-driven assessment are inappropriate and are likely to be declined or redirected.
We understand some providers are referring adult ADHD patients to Pinnacle services. While we will provide what support we can, our capacity in this area is limited.
New rules for prescribing ADHD medications came into effect on 1 February 2026.
Key points for prescribers in Waikato:
The community liaison psychiatrist does not see patients for assessment. Vocationally registered GPs and NPs who have completed appropriate ADHD assessment training may consult the liaison psychiatrist for diagnostic and management advice on patients they have assessed. The psychiatrist is not able to endorse or certify new ADHD diagnoses by non-vocationally registered or untrained clinicians, or where a comprehensive assessment has not been completed.

The Te Tumu Waiora integrated mental health and wellbeing service has been up and running in general practices in Taupō and Tūrangi since July 2019. The response from practices and the community has been overwhelmingly positive.
